 FORCES SWEETHEARTS RAISE MONEY FOR RCF

FORCES SWEETHEARTS RAISE MONEY FOR RCF  

Beryl Korman (pictured left) and Liz Biddle (far right) are seen here presenting a giant cheque for £2147.68 to RCF Chairman Peter Foot. The magnificent sum was collected during 2010 performances of their touring production Forces Sweethearts at theatres up and down the UK. This happy picture was taken by Fund Administrator Mary Doyle in the beautiful gardens of Liz and Beryl's Larg House in Coulsdon where they run their music agency Upbeat Management. (You can see the gardens for yourself on May 15th when they are opened in aid of the Fund and the Royal Marsden Cancer Charity - see news item below!)

 Garden Open Day 2011

Garden Open Day 2011  

Garden Open Day 2011

The Garden Open Day on 15th May 2011 was a huge success and to date in excess of £7k has been raised - which will be shared between the Royal Castle Fund and the Royal Marsden Cancer Charity. The Mayor of Sutton kindly said a few words followed by Fiona Castle, patron of the Roy Castle Fund, who then opened the proceedings. The weather just held off long enough for everyone to enjoy the music of Atlantis, Gary James and James Vickery - plus all the stalls that dotted the garden. The money raised on the tombola is being matched by The National Grid. The money from the gate is being matched by Newton Honda, Croydon, and the raffle money by Barclays Bank. Sponsorship was also received from Sainsbury's in Wallington, Tesco in Purley, El Nido Spanish Restaurant in Wallington and Kall Kwik Printing in Leatherhead! The cafe was busy all afternoon, serving hot dogs, cream teas and Krispy Kreme donuts. And a great time was had by all!
